Core Functionality
XOutput is a tool that allows you to convert DirectInput signals into XInput (Xbox 360 Controller) signals.
-
Controller Emulation:
- It creates a virtual Xbox 360 controller in Windows.
- This allows older controllers (like old gamepads, steering wheels, or arcade sticks) that are not natively compatible with modern games to work seamlessly.
- Many modern PC games only support XInput (Xbox controllers); this tool bridges that gap.
-
Mapping & Customization:
- Button Remapping: You can map any button on your physical controller to any button on the virtual Xbox controller (e.g., map a physical "Square" button to the virtual "X" button).
- Axis Mapping: Convert analog sticks, D-pads, or even throttles to the standard Xbox analog sticks.
- Trigger Conversion: It can convert "combined axis" inputs (common in older gamepads where L2/R2 shared a single axis) into independent left and right triggers.
-
Force Feedback (Rumble) Support:
- Version 0.11 includes support for translating force feedback commands from the game (XInput) back to the physical controller (DirectInput), allowing you to feel vibrations even with older hardware.
-
Multiple Device Support:
- You can use multiple controllers simultaneously. XOutput creates unique virtual controllers for each physical device connected.

This essay examines XOutput v0.11, a specialized software tool designed to bridge the gap between legacy game controllers and modern PC gaming environments. The Role of XOutput v0.11
At its core, XOutput v0.11 is a DirectInput-to-XInput wrapper. Its primary purpose is to allow "DirectInput" devices—such as older joysticks, generic USB gamepads, or flight sticks—to be recognized by Windows as "XInput" devices, effectively emulating an Xbox 360 controller. This is critical because many modern PC games, particularly those on Steam or major AAA titles like The Witcher or Fallout 4, often only provide native support for XInput. Technical Features and Changes The Bridge Between Retro and Modern: A Review of XOutput v0
Version 0.11 was released as a minor update focused on stability and essential user interface improvements. Key technical highlights include:
Controller Management: Fixes for issues related to swapping controller positions and disabling active controllers.
Exclusivity Toggle: The addition of a checkbox to toggle "controller exclusivity," which helps prevent games from seeing both the original DirectInput device and the emulated XInput device simultaneously.
Ease of Use: Implementation of icons in the controller options window to aid visual navigation. Implementation and Setup
Using the XOutput.v0.11.zip file involves a straightforward setup process often cited in gaming communities like r/killerinstinct:
Driver Dependency: Users must typically install the official Xbox 360 Controller driver (built into Windows 10/11) and a virtual bus driver like the ScpDriver.
Mapping: After launching the software, players map their specific controller axes and buttons to the corresponding Xbox inputs.
Activation: Once configured, clicking "Start" initiates the emulation, making the legacy controller "visible" to modern games. Security and Community Warnings
While the software is a staple for enthusiasts, the community has issued strong warnings regarding its source. Users should only download the utility from verified repositories like ericlbarrett on GitHub. Malicious third-party sites (such as the now-defunct xoutput.net) have been known to distribute malware under the same name.

The Technical Necessity
At its core, XOutput is a software wrapper. Its primary function is to intercept signals from a DirectInput device—such as an older Logitech gamepad, a flight stick, or even a generic "no-name" controller—and emulate them as a virtual Xbox 360 controller. This is vital because many modern titles, particularly those ported from consoles, do not natively recognize the button mapping or axis configurations of older devices. By "tricking" the operating system into seeing a standard XInput device, XOutput restores full compatibility without requiring the user to purchase new hardware. Performance and Customization
Version 0.11 of XOutput brought several refinements to the user experience, emphasizing low latency and high customizability. Unlike generic drivers, XOutput allows users to map specific buttons, triggers, and analog sticks with precision. This level of granularity is essential for competitive gaming and simulation, where dead-zone calibration and axis inversion can be the difference between success and failure. The tool's lightweight nature ensures that the emulation process does not tax the system's CPU, maintaining the high frame rates gamers demand. Accessibility and Sustainability
